Universal Tensile Testing Machine Market - Global Forecast 2026-2032

The Universal Tensile Testing Machine Market size was estimated at USD 281.38 million in 2025 and expected to reach USD 304.66 million in 2026, at a CAGR of 8.12% to reach USD 486.18 million by 2032.

Discover how universal tensile testing machines serve as essential tools for material innovation, delivering precision, reliability, and actionable insights

Universal tensile testing machines serve as the cornerstone of mechanical materials evaluation, providing indispensable data on strength, ductility, and fracture behavior. These advanced load frames apply precisely controlled forces to specimens while capturing detailed stress–strain relationships, enabling engineers and researchers to validate material performance under varied conditions. As industries pursue lighter, stronger, and more durable materials, the demand for high-fidelity testing solutions that deliver repeatable and accurate results has never been greater.

Over the past decade, these systems have evolved from purely mechanical devices to sophisticated platforms integrating high-speed digital extensometers and noncontact optical sensors for submicron strain measurement. High-speed cameras capable of capturing thousands of frames per second now reveal real-time deformation mechanisms, while AI-powered image processing enhances the detection of microcrack initiation and propagation during testing. Concurrently, the incorporation of IoT-enabled sensors and cloud-based data analytics facilitates remote monitoring and predictive maintenance of testing equipment, enabling laboratories to optimize uptime and resource allocation with unprecedented precision.

In this dynamic environment, universal tensile testing machines catalyze innovation across aerospace, automotive, medical devices, and advanced materials sectors. By delivering comprehensive mechanical property profiles, these systems underpin critical decisions-from material selection to quality assurance-ensuring that engineered components meet rigorous safety and performance standards. As manufacturers and research institutions increasingly prioritize data-driven insights, universal tensile testing machines remain essential instruments in the pursuit of next-generation material solutions.

Explore the dynamic transformation of tensile testing technology driven by automation, smart analytics, and sustainable design reshaping industry standards

The landscape of universal tensile testing is experiencing a profound transformation driven by the convergence of automation, smart analytics, and sustainable design principles. Automated test cells now orchestrate multiple machines simultaneously, executing complex test sequences with minimal human intervention and reducing cycle times by up to 30 percent. Embedded AI chips such as NVIDIA Jetson and Google Edge TPU perform on-device analytics, enabling real-time anomaly detection and adaptive control of loading conditions to optimize test fidelity and resource utilization. Meanwhile, IoT integration across test platforms captures machine health metrics, feeding predictive maintenance algorithms that decrease unplanned downtime by as much as 25 percent in industrial laboratories.

Material innovation is further driving demand for modular testing architectures that support interchangeable load cells, environmental chambers, and high-temperature furnaces. As high-performance composites and bioresorbable polymers emerge across aerospace and biomedical applications, testing requirements have expanded to include cyclic fatigue, creep, and corrosion resistance under simulated service conditions. Manufacturers respond by offering bench-type testers with rapid-change fixtures and software-driven automation interfaces that seamlessly transition between testing modes, accelerating development cycles and reducing capital expenditure.

Sustainability imperatives are reshaping product design and end-of-life considerations, prompting the adoption of energy-efficient servo-hydraulic systems and eco-friendly materials in machine construction. Remote access and digital twin technology not only streamline workflow but also enhance traceability and regulatory compliance across global supply chains. This multifaceted evolution is redefining performance benchmarks and empowering organizations to harness mechanical insights more efficiently than ever before.

Unpacking the far-reaching effects of the 2025 United States tariffs on tensile testing equipment supply chains, costs, and strategic sourcing decisions

In April 2025, the United States implemented sweeping tariff measures that directly affect the procurement and operational costs of tensile testing equipment. A universal 10 percent tariff on most imported goods took effect on April 5, 2025, with country-specific surcharges introducing further complexity. For example, steel and aluminum imports now incur a 25 percent duty, while aluminum from Russia faces a staggering 200 percent levy. These policies aim to bolster domestic production but have raised landed costs and elongated lead times for testing machine components, such as load cells and hydraulic pumps.

Subsequent adjustments on April 9, 2025, introduced reciprocal tariffs based on bilateral trade imbalances, affecting key suppliers of testing systems and consumables. China, already subject to Section 301 duties, now faces cumulative rates of up to 145 percent on lab-related goods, including precision instruments and optical extensometers. Conversely, Canada and Mexico maintain preferential treatment under USMCA, with noncompliant goods facing a 25 percent tariff and energy products a 10 percent levy, shielding North American manufacturers from the steepest increases.

These tariff fluctuations have compelled laboratories and OEMs to reevaluate sourcing strategies, pivot toward domestic or USMCA-compliant suppliers, and renegotiate service agreements to mitigate cost pressures. While the reorientation supports national supply chain resilience, it also underscores the strategic importance of diversification and long-term procurement planning in an increasingly protectionist trade environment.

Explore how machine type, material composition, end-use industries, testing modes, technological sophistication, and sales channels define market segmentation strategies

Market segmentation for universal tensile testing machines encompasses multiple dimensions, beginning with machine type where the landscape spans electromechanical frames known for precision and speed, servo-hydraulic systems prized for high-force applications, and compact tabletop testers that cater to space-constrained laboratories. Material-based segmentation reveals distinct requirements for ceramics, composites, metals, and polymers. Ceramics divide into oxide and non-oxide classes demanding specialized grips and heating assemblies. Fiber-reinforced and particle-reinforced composites necessitate adaptable fixtures and displacement control. Metal testing distinguishes aluminum, copper, and steel, each with unique stress–strain characteristics. Polymers, both thermoplastics and thermosets, require low-load cells and extensometers optimized for ductility measurements.

End-user industries drive diverse testing modes and protocol requirements. Aerospace applications-spanning commercial airframes and defense components-prioritize fatigue life and fracture toughness, whereas automotive validations address both OEM structures and aftermarket parts under tension, compression, and bend tests. Infrastructure and residential construction materials undergo stringent shear and compression evaluations. Heavy and light manufacturing sectors require combined tension and bend testing for welded assemblies and sheet metals. Medical device testers evaluate implants and instruments under uniaxial and biaxial tension to meet regulatory standards. Research institutes and universities conduct foundational studies under low-cycle fatigue and high-cycle endurance modes.

Technology platforms incorporate computerized hardware integration, digital interfaces such as LCD screens and touchscreen controls, and manual solutions featuring handwheel operation and mechanical gauges. Instrumentation advancements drive the adoption of hardware–software synergy in high-capacity frames, while sales channels range from direct OEM contracts supporting custom installations to distributor networks delivering off-the-shelf and online procurement models.

Unveil critical regional dynamics shaping the universal tensile testing machine market across the Americas, Europe-Middle East-Africa, and Asia-Pacific regions

The Americas region remains a foundational market for universal tensile testing machines, anchored by robust aerospace, automotive, and medical device sectors. United States laboratories leverage a mature service infrastructure and generous R&D incentives to adopt automated, AI-capable systems. Canada and Mexico benefit from USMCA provisions, shielding certain equipment from the steepest tariffs and supporting seamless cross-border distribution and aftermarket support. Investments in domestic manufacturing and calibration services reinforce supply chain continuity, enabling rapid turnaround of test parts and consumables.

Europe, Middle East & Africa exhibit heterogeneous growth patterns driven by stringent regulatory frameworks and sustainability mandates. Western European nations prioritize eco-friendly, energy-efficient test platforms compliant with REACH and CE directives, while emerging markets in the Middle East invest in advanced testing suites for oil & gas, infrastructure, and defense applications. Africa’s gradually expanding manufacturing base, particularly in South Africa and Nigeria, increases demand for versatile machines capable of multi-axis tension and compression tests under demanding conditions.

Asia-Pacific has emerged as the fastest-growing territory for tensile testing solutions, propelled by aggressive industrialization in China, India, and Southeast Asia. Government initiatives emphasize “Made in China 2025” and India’s production-linked incentives, channeling investments into local machine calibration and IoT-enabled monitoring systems. The region’s expanding electronics and automotive industries, coupled with large-scale infrastructure projects, underpin sustained demand for high-throughput, modular tensile testing equipment.

Delve into the strategic initiatives and innovative leadership driving growth and differentiation among top universal tensile testing machine providers

Leading manufacturers of universal tensile testing machines are adopting multifaceted strategies to strengthen market positions and capture emerging opportunities. Instron, under Illinois Tool Works, has ramped production of AI-powered load frames that integrate machine learning algorithms for real-time data analysis and error detection in automotive and aerospace testing environments. ZwickRoell’s modular testing solutions, featuring quick-change fixtures and digital control interfaces, have reduced setup times by nearly 25 percent, catering to research labs and high-mix production workflows demanding versatility.

Shimadzu has introduced eco-friendly universal testing machines with optimized hydraulic circuits that reduce energy consumption by up to 20 percent, meeting stringent environmental standards in European and North American markets. CEO statements highlight investments in touchscreen-driven human–machine interfaces and voice-command modules to simplify operator interaction and training requirements. MTS Systems and Tinius Olsen expand global service networks, establishing calibration centers across Asia-Pacific and the Middle East, ensuring compliance with local standards and minimizing logistical disruptions. Meanwhile, emerging regional players in China and India are leveraging cost-efficient designs coupled with local support models, closing the gap on advanced feature sets through partnerships with control electronics and sensor technology specialists.
